The OTDR Launch Fiber box is used with Optical Time Domain Reflectometers (OTDR's) to help minimize the effects of the OTDR's launch pulse on measurement uncertainty.

What is the purpose of the KOMSHINE Fiber Optic OTDR Launch Cable Box?
Answer: The KOMSHINE Fiber Optic OTDR Launch Cable Box is designed to eliminate dead zones in Optical Time Domain Reflectometer (OTDR) testing. By providing a known length of fiber before the test starts, it helps ensure accurate readings and efficient identification of faults. This functionality is crucial in ensuring high-quality fiber optic installations and testing. What type of fiber does the KOMSHINE OTDR Cable Box support?
Answer: The KOMSHINE OTDR Launch Cable Box supports singlemode fiber, specifically optimized for wavelengths of 1310nm and 1550nm. Singlemode fiber is ideal for long-distance communication as it allows higher bandwidth and is less susceptible to signal loss over distances compared to multimode fiber. What connectors are used with the KOMSHINE OTDR Launch Cable Box?
Answer: The KOMSHINE OTDR Launch Cable Box features FC-UPC connectors on both ends, known for their low insertion loss and high return loss characteristics. This helps maintain the integrity of the optical signal during testing. FC-UPC connectors are ideal for precision applications such as OTDR testing, where signal quality is critical. Features & Benefits
- - Optic fiber jump cable for testing fiber optic cables
- - Helps minimize the effects of OTDR's launch pulse on measurement uncertainty
- - Non-metal construction is water and dust proof
- - Each OTDR launch cable can be used as an OTDR transmitting and receiving cable
- - Typical Loss: < 1dB @1310nm for 1000 meters
- - Small size, lightweight, and easy to carry
